    What Does "Iarrived at Sorting Hub Artinya" Mean?

    Let's dive right into the heart of the matter. The phrase "Iarrived at sorting hub artinya" translates to "arrived at the sorting hub" in English. A sorting hub is a central facility where packages are received, sorted, and then dispatched to their next destination. Think of it as a crucial midpoint in your package's journey from the sender to your doorstep. When you see this status update, it means your package has successfully reached one of these hubs and is now being processed for the next leg of its trip.

    The Role of Sorting Hubs in Package Delivery

    Sorting hubs play a vital role in the efficiency of package delivery. Imagine a world without them – packages would be routed directly from the sender to the recipient, leading to a chaotic and inefficient system. Sorting hubs streamline the process by:

    • Consolidating Shipments: Hubs bring together packages from various origins, allowing for efficient routing based on destination.
    • Sorting and Processing: Packages are sorted according to their final destination and prepared for the next stage of transportation.
    • Optimizing Routes: Hubs enable logistics companies to optimize delivery routes, reducing transit times and fuel consumption.
    • Tracking and Visibility: Sorting hubs provide crucial tracking points, allowing both senders and recipients to monitor the progress of their shipments.

    Decoding the Delivery Process: A Step-by-Step Guide

    To fully grasp the significance of "Iarrived at sorting hub artinya," let's take a closer look at the typical package delivery process:

    1. Package Originates: The sender prepares the package and hands it over to the shipping carrier.
    2. Initial Scan: The carrier scans the package, creating an initial tracking record.
    3. Transit to Sorting Hub: The package is transported to the nearest sorting hub.
    4. Arrival at Sorting Hub: The package arrives at the sorting hub and is scanned again.
    5. Sorting and Processing: The package is sorted based on its destination and prepared for the next leg of the journey.
    6. Departure from Sorting Hub: The package leaves the sorting hub and is transported to the next hub or directly to the delivery destination.
    7. Final Delivery: The package arrives at the recipient's address and is delivered.

    Understanding Tracking Updates

    Throughout this process, you'll receive various tracking updates, each providing a snapshot of your package's current status. Some common updates include:

    • "In Transit:" This indicates that your package is moving between locations.
    • "Out for Delivery:" This means your package is on its way to your address and will be delivered soon.
    • "Delivered:" This confirms that your package has been successfully delivered.
    • "Exception:" This indicates an unexpected delay or issue, such as a weather-related disruption or a misrouted package.

    Common Scenarios and What They Mean

    Let's explore some common scenarios you might encounter while tracking your packages:

    • Package Stuck at Sorting Hub: If your package remains at a sorting hub for an extended period, it could indicate a delay due to high volume, weather conditions, or internal processing issues. Contact the carrier for more information.
    • Incorrect Address: If the tracking information indicates an incorrect address, contact the carrier immediately to correct the information and prevent delivery delays.
    • Package Damaged: If your package arrives damaged, document the damage with photos and contact the carrier to file a claim.
    • Package Lost: If your package is lost, contact the carrier to initiate a search and file a claim if necessary.

    The Future of Sorting Hubs: Innovation and Technology

    The world of logistics is constantly evolving, and sorting hubs are at the forefront of innovation. As e-commerce continues to grow, sorting hubs are becoming increasingly automated and efficient. Advanced technologies such as robotics, artificial intelligence, and machine learning are being implemented to streamline processes, reduce errors, and improve delivery times.

    Automation and Robotics

    Automation and robotics are revolutionizing sorting hubs, automating tasks such as package sorting, labeling, and loading. This reduces the need for manual labor, increases efficiency, and minimizes the risk of errors.

    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ning

    AI and machine learning are being used to optimize delivery routes, predict potential delays, and personalize the customer experience. These technologies enable logistics companies to make data-driven decisions and improve the overall efficiency of their operations.

    The Rise of Micro-Fulfillment Centers

    Micro-fulfillment centers are smaller, localized sorting hubs that are strategically located in urban areas. These centers enable faster delivery times and reduce the distance packages need to travel, particularly for last-mile delivery.
